An 'independent special rapporteur' will examine reports of Chinese meddling in recent elections.
Canadian Prime Minister Justin Trudeau has said that an independent special rapporteur will probe alleged Chinese interference in their recent elections.
"I will be appointing an independent special rapporteur, who will have a wide mandate and make expert recommendations on combating interference and strengthening our democracy," Mr Trudeau said. A federal public report last week found that efforts to meddle in the 2021 federal election did not affect the results.
"The way to stop foreign actors from acting in secret is to refuse to keep their secrets," said New Democrat MP Peter Julian. "We will abide by their recommendation," he said, calling the decision one of the official's first tasks after being appointed.
